Hotel at a Glance: Maingate Lakeside Resort

If the kids haven't spent all their energy scurrying around Orlando's theme parks, then you can count on Maingate Lakeside Resort to keep them busy once you've gotten back to the hotel. From its spot overlooking picturesque Black Lake, this sprawling campus features such kid-friendly amenities as a mini-golf course, an arcade, and two playgrounds.

  • Distance from Walt Disney World® Theme Parks: less than 2 miles
  • Take the shuttle to area theme parks to avoid parking hassles.
  • Take a dip in three onsite full-size swimming pools; there are also two kids' pools.
  • Bring your pooch: The hotel is pet-friendly and there's even a dog park on site (additional fees apply).

Kissimmee, Florida: Easy Access to World-Famous Theme Parks and Major Orlando Attractions

Located on the banks of Lake Tohopekaliga, Kissimmee sits about 22 miles from downtown Orlando and just 16 miles from the Walt Disney World® Theme Parks. The world’s most-visited entertainment resort spans roughly 30,000 acres, encompassing four theme parks, two water parks, five golf courses, and the Disney Springs® Area. There’s no shortage of things to do here: begin your day at Magic Kingdom® Park by boarding a rocket-shaped three-seater that climbs to 180 feet before entering a deep black tunnel and racing past stars, satellites, and constellations. After that, ride a dune buggy through a haunted mansion. For dinner, head over to Epcot® to sample cuisine from Morocco, Mexico, France, Italy, and several other countries. As one of the most popular family destinations in the world, sunny Orlando is home to other theme parks including Universal Orlando Resort and SeaWorld Orlando.

Those hoping to shake up the typical theme-park-dominated itinerary can head into downtown Orlando's vibrant arts district. The neighborhood boasts venues such as the CityArts Factory, a multifaceted patchwork of gallery spaces, and SAK Comedy Lab, which holds improv shows five nights a week.
